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Embedded Software Engineer - C for Vehicle Systems

Kasmo Global

please look for a Controls Engineer with 5+ years of experience in model-based controls development (MATLAB/Simulink/Stateflow) and powertrain systems/ Electric Powertrain Control Systems experience.

Job Title


75358-1 - Embedded Software Engineer 3


Duration


12 months Contract with possible extension


Location


Mossville, IL - Onsite Role

Client


Caterpillar

Position's Contributions to Work Group:

- The controls engineer position within the Electric Powertrain Control Systems team will be responsible for powertrain controls design, development, simulation, and validation for Electric Powertrain products. The position will develop common, leveraged control features to support various electrified powertrain system architectures. The position will collaborate with a global team to solve technical problems and deliver on project goals. This role directly impacts Caterpillar current and future electrified powertrain products.

Candidate Value Proposition

Why Caterpillar? "Whether it be ground-breaking products, best in class solutions or a lifelong career, you can build what matters to you at Caterpillar. With 150 locations in countries around the world, what you create at Caterpillar travels and helps people around the world. You can collaborate with the best minds in the industry, complete meaningful work and continuously grow and develop through our various opportunities. Here, you can do the work that matters."

Typical task breakdown:

- Developing powertrain controls requirements based on machine level performance / functional requirements.

- Developing leverageable control features for various electromechanical system architectures through model-based controls development.

- Utilize virtual product development for control system functional testing, powertrain optimization, and performance verification.

- Developing and validating powertrain control features through simulation, lab, and machine development utilizing CAN and ethernet based development tools.

- nalyzing data, investigating issues for root cause, and documenting powertrain control feature functionality and performance

- Collaborating with process partners to deliver high quality product.

Interaction with team:

- Frequent collaboration

Team Structure

- bout 20 people on the team, 4 team leads, reports into a team lead

Work environment:

- Office, lab or machine development environment

Education & Experience Required:

- Years of experience: 5 or more years related experience required

- Degree requirement: Bachelor's degree in Mechanical, Electrical, Mechatronics, or Equivalent Engineering

- With an advanced degree willing to consider candidates with 2 or more years related experience

- Do you accept internships as job experience: No

- re there past or additional job titles or roles that would provide comparable background to this role: A lot of our candidates come from the automotive industry with software and hands-on experience. Comparable job title would be Controls Engineer depending on relevant experience.

Top 3 Skills:

- Experience in model-based controls development using Matlab Simulink and Stateflow.

- Experience with virtual product development

- Experience with lab, machine, or vehicle development

Additional Technical Skills

(Required)

- Experience developing electromechanical, transmission, hybrid, or powertrain controls

- Experience in model-based controls development using Matlab Simulink and Stateflow.

- Experience with virtual product development

- Experience with control software development tools and processes

- Experience with lab or machine development

- Experience with CAN development tools: Vector CANape, CANalyzer or ATI Vision

Soft Skills

(Required)

- Strong analytical and problem-solving skills

- Strong technical leadership skills and communication
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Embedded Software Engineer - C for Vehicle Systems in Mossville, IL vacancy
  •  ...Join one of the top Earth-Moving Vehicle Manufacturing Company as an Embedded Software Engineer. Details as below:...  ...software for electronics control systems supporting diesel engine and battery...  ...software focus Top 3 Skills: C programming Model Based Development... 
    Suggested
    Contract work
    Work experience placement

    Net2Source (N2S)

    Mossville, IL
    17 hours ago
  • $90k - $100k

     ...Services Join a dynamic engineering team focused on developing...  ..., and testing embedded software features for machine safety systems. Key Responsibilities Develop...  ...Embedded C++ development C test and G test suites Datalinks...  ...Manufacturing, Motor Vehicle Manufacturing, and Motor... 
    Suggested
    Full time

    L&T Technology Services

    Mossville, IL
    1 day ago
  •  ...person will work with the whole system design for machine controls...  ...and interfaces. SYSTEMS ENGINEER Location:Mossville il 100%...  ...harness, electronic hardware and software teams to ensure all systems...  ...knowledge (required) • Embedded C software experience (nice to... 
    Suggested

    Kasmo Global

    Mossville, IL
    2 days ago
  •  ...Responsibilities: • Design and implement software of embedded devices and systems from requirements to production and...  .... Solid programming experience in C or C++ • Knowledge of computer...  ...in computer science, software engineering or relevant field required. • 2-4... 
    Suggested

    3B Staffing LLC

    Mossville, IL
    3 days ago
  •  ...Autonomy Test Engineer This resource will join our Autonomy team at the...  ...riding in our autonomy surrogate vehicles (SUV & pickup trucks) performing system testing. Responsibilities:...  ...the onboard autonomy system. New software is regularly received by the team... 
    Suggested
    Work at office
    Day shift

    Samprasoft

    Mossville, IL
    4 days ago
  • $57.9 per hour

     ...Job Description Job Title: Embedded Software Engineer Location: Mossville, IL Zip Code: 61552 Duration...  ...features on embedded electronic control systems and vision system for use in remote...  ...based embedded applications in Embedded C and MATLAB/Simulink aligned with system... 
    Work experience placement
    Local area
    Immediate start
    Remote work

    Belcan

    Mossville, IL
    1 day ago
  • $50 - $55 per hour

     ...and test the low-layer software, such as OS integration...  ...support and advise other engineers, managers, marketing...  ...solutions, coding solution in C, manage versioning,...  ...: Real world real-time embedded device driver...  ...diagnostics, operating system configurations, non-volatile... 
    Hourly pay
    Contract work
    Work experience placement
    Internship

    Randstad

    Mossville, IL
    19 hours ago
  • $97.53k - $146.29k

     ...Career Area: Engineering Job Description: Your Work Shapes...  ...in it. The Core Engine Software Developer is responsible...  ..., and release of embedded control software that operates...  ...Caterpillar engine systems. This role supports delivery...  ...) and/or embedded C Execute software verification... 
    Part time
    Relocation
    Flexible hours

    Caterpillar

    Mossville, IL
    17 hours ago
  •  ...Bachelor's degree in Electrical Engineering, Computer Engineering, or Computer Science with an embedded software focus. No 2‑year degrees will...  ...of industry experience in C programming. Model-Based Development...  ...Ethernet). Embedded Operating System experience. Scripting... 
    Internship

    Rose International

    Mossville, IL
    4 days ago
  • $77k

     ...Apply the principles of electrical engineering, computer science and mathematical analysis...  ..., testing, and evaluation of the embedded software and systems that make electrical and computer components...  ...Experience developing APIs with C Knowledge of Hardware in the loop... 

    HarveyNashUSA

    Mossville, IL
    1 day ago
  •  ...Role: Embedded Software Engineer 4 Location: Mossville, IL (Onsite) Duration: 6-month...  ..., and planning layers to ensure systems are scalable and maintainable. • Production...  ...sensors (LiDAR, Radar, Camera) and vehicle networks. • Mentorship: Set coding... 
    Contract work
    Remote work
    Relocation

    Tech Tammina

    Mossville, IL
    17 hours ago
  •  ...and test the low-layer software, such as OS integration...  ...support and advise other engineers, managers, marketing...  ...solutions, coding solution in C, manage versioning,...  ...Real world real-time embedded device driver experience...  ...diagnostics, operating system configurations, non-... 
    Work experience placement
    Internship

    Samprasoft

    Mossville, IL
    4 days ago
  •  ...Job Description: Job Titles: Embedded Software Engineer Location: Mossville, IL (Onsite) About the Role We...  ...part of a global engineering organization developing vehicle-level autonomous systems (L6) that integrate both software and hardware solutions... 
    Internship

    Futran Tech Solutions Pvt. Ltd.

    Mossville, IL
    2 days ago
  • $57.82 per hour

     ...Embedded Software Engineer Job Number: 365865 Category: Embedded Sys / Software Eng Description...  ...evaluation of the embedded software and systems that make computers work. A typical...  ...software. Solid programming experience in C or C++ Knowledge of computer... 
    Local area
    Immediate start

    Belcan

    Mossville, IL
    1 day ago
  •  ...Science or Electrical Engineering Qualifications:...  ...experience with real-time embedded device drivers Top...  ...display, or telematics software Proficiency in Git for...  ..., Bash Shell, ANSI C, Python Agile software...  ...Troubleshooting and system changes Job Duties... 
    Work experience placement

    ThreePDS Inc.

    Mossville, IL
    3 days ago
  • $110k - $135k

     ...for completing general embedded software development assignments...  ...electrical projects for vehicle chassis, and/or components, and/or systems. To develop embedded...  ...meet design compliance to Engineering Standards, product...  ...development experience in C on embedded platforms,... 
    Remote work

    KOMATSU AMERICA

    Peoria, IL
    17 hours ago
  •  ...Core Requirements Embedded C programming (absence of C is a disqualifier) Knowledge of embedded systems and software architecture Experience with CAN communication...  ...Title Embedded Software Engineer: Req# 82678-1 Duration... 
    Contract work
    Internship
    Relocation

    Kasmo Global

    Mossville, IL
    4 days ago
  •  ...Embedded Software Engineer Hybrid in Mossville, IL (Peoria area) 12-Month Contract with possible...  ...evaluation of the embedded software and systems that make computers work. A typical embedded...  ...and designer will develop embedded ‘C’ and/or C++ code software solutions to... 
    Contract work
    Internship

    Software Technology Inc

    Mossville, IL
    3 days ago
  •  ...Work: This is a position for a software engineer to develop Telematics on-...  ...working closely with Telematics systems engineers, and Telematics...  ...development experience using Objective C, C# or C++ (with emphasis on...  .... Three to five years of embedded software experience.... 

    krg technology inc

    Mossville, IL
    17 hours ago
  •  ...Network, Inc. (DSN) is seeking a full-time Senior C++ Software Engineer (Autonomous Systems) to join our team in Mossville, IL OR Pittsburgh, PA OR...  ...software with sensors, actuators, compute platforms, and vehicle networks (e.g., CAN, Ethernet) Lead debugging and root... 
    Full time

    Diversified Services Network

    Mossville, IL
    3 days ago
  •  ...Title: Embedded Software Engineer Location: Mossville, IL- Hybrid Contract role Skills...  ..., hardware diagnostics, operating system configurations, non-volatile memory interfacing...  ...patterns and anti-patterns, ANSI C, Python, and other programming languages... 
    Contract work
    Internship

    Suncap Technology

    Mossville, IL
    3 days ago
  • $42 per hour

     ...Embedded Software Engineer — Mossville, IL, USA Job Code: PAN-00000013 · Employment Type: CTC, W2 · Tax Term: C2...  ...to contribute to embedded control software for vehicle and machine systems. This role focuses on C-based firmware development, model-based design... 

    Rose INT

    Mossville, IL
    6 days ago
  • $103.71k - $138.28k

     ...provide independent efforts to all aspects of system integration including design, analysis,...  ...experience in system architecture and engineering disciplines. Specific technical...  ...checks for criminal records and/or motor vehicle reports and/or drug screening, depending... 
    Full time
    Temporary work
    Remote work

    Lumen

    Peoria, IL
    2 days ago
  •  ...Software Developer The Client’s Autonomy Connectivity team provides connectivity software, systems, and solutions to the Client’s Autonomy Division, connecting...  ...other developers and engineers as part of cross...  ...used may include: WiFi mesh, C-V2X (or similar), WiFi, cellular... 

    Samprasoft

    Mossville, IL
    4 days ago
  • $44 - $46.85 per hour

     ...Systems Engineer This position is for a systems engineer for the development and integration of advanced technology with heavy-duty equipment...  .... This includes the integration of sensors, components, and software for automation & autonomy products. Location: Mossville,... 
    Hourly pay
    Contract work

    Randstad

    Mossville, IL
    4 days ago
  •  ...Job Title: Software Systems Engineer Job Overview: We are seeking a Software Systems Engineer to create comprehensive systems and...  ...Engineering, or Computer Science. ~3-7 years of experience in embedded software design, system engineering, or web/windows... 
    Remote work

    Kasmo Global

    Mossville, IL
    4 days ago
  • $44 - $46.85 per hour

    job summary: This position is for a systems engineer for the development and integration of advanced technology with heavy-duty equipment...  ...This includes the integration of sensors, components, and software for automation & autonomy products.   location: Mossville... 
    Hourly pay
    Contract work
    Temporary work
    Work experience placement

    Randstad

    Mossville, IL
    4 days ago
  •  ...3-5 years Degree requirement: Bachelor’s in EE, CE, CS, Network/Systems Engineering. Do you accept internships as job experience: Yes, if related to connectivity, networking, or embedded systems. Are there past or additional job titles or roles that would... 
    Internship
    Remote work
    Shift work

    HCL USAAvance Consulting

    Mossville, IL
    1 day ago
  •  ...from time to time. Focus is really around software around autonomy control, satellite...  ...with dev team to create test plan, create system design, develop a validation plan for the...  ...working or not. Top skills: System engineering Validation Any kind of network... 
    Remote work

    Futran Tech Solutions Pvt. Ltd.

    Mossville, IL
    18 hours ago
  • $49.12 per hour

     ...Systems Engineer 3 Job Number: 365838 Category: Systems Engineering Description: Job Title: Systems Engineer 3 Location: Mossville...  ...analysis to the design, development, testing, and evaluation of the software and systems that make computers work. A typical systems... 
    Local area
    Immediate start

    Belcan

    Mossville, IL
    1 day 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Embedded Software Engineer - C for Vehicle Systems. Be the first to apply!